What is an entry coding job?

Entry coding jobs are positions designed for individuals who are new to programming or software development. These roles typically require basic knowledge of programming languages such as Python, Java, or JavaScript and may involve tasks like writing simple code, debugging, or assisting with software testing. Entry-level coding jobs are ideal for recent graduates or career changers looking to gain hands-on experience in the tech industry. They often provide on-the-job training and opportunities to learn from more experienced developers. With time and experience, entry-level coders can advance to more complex programming or software engineering roles.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an entry-level coder?

To thrive as an Entry-Level Coder, you need a solid understanding of programming fundamentals, problem-solving abilities, and familiarity with at least one programming language, often demonstrated through a relevant degree or coding bootcamp. Experience with code editors, version control systems like Git, and debugging tools is typically required. Attention to detail, a willingness to learn, and effective communication help you collaborate and grow in fast-paced development environments. These skills are crucial for producing reliable code, integrating smoothly with teams, and adapting to evolving technical requirements.

What are some common challenges faced by entry-level coders, and how can they overcome them?

Entry-level coders often encounter challenges such as debugging unfamiliar code, adapting to team coding standards, and learning new technologies quickly. To overcome these obstacles, it's helpful to ask questions early and often, utilize code review feedback, and take advantage of onboarding resources or mentorship programs. Staying organized, breaking tasks into manageable steps, and building strong communication with more experienced team members can also ease the transition and promote growth.

Position Summary

We have an exciting opportunity to join our team as a Senior Business Manager - Radiology. The Business Manager of the Radiology Department is responsible for managing the operational, financial, and administrative functions that support high-quality, efficient, and patient-centered care. This role emphasizes optimizing scheduling, supply chain management, revenue cycle performance, resource utilization, equipment purchasing, and budget oversight to ensure the department meets both clinical and organizational objectives. The Business Manager acts as a key liaison between clinical leadership, hospital administration, and ancillary services, ensuring compliance with institutional policies, payer requirements, and regulatory standards, while fostering operational excellence through data-driven decision-making and ongoing process improvement.

Job Responsibilities Scheduling, Registration, Pre-Authorizations, and Workflow Optimization
  • Oversee daily, weekly, and long-term scheduling of procedures, balancing physician availability, staff/equipment resources, and patient demand.
    • Maintain operational expertise across all aspects of Radiology/IR scheduling and registration, with the ability to provide direct coverage when needed.
    • Maintains a detailed instructional manual for all aspects of scheduling, obtaining pre-authorization, and registration, and uses it to train new staff and support ongoing competency.
    • Monitors and addresses overall and individual performance using metrics, audits, and direct observations.
  • Implement strategies to maximize utilization of procedure rooms, equipment, and staff while minimizing patient delays and cancellations.
  • Partner with physician leadership to develop evidence-based scheduling templates that align with clinical priorities and operational benchmarks.
  • Monitor performance metrics to enhance efficiency and patient access.
